Default [FS] High-End PCM1704-based DAC Kit

This DAC kit utilizes the ultra high-end 24bit/96KHz PCM1704 that is capable of 8x upsampling at an amazing 768KHz.

When completed, the LITE DAC-38T board would look somewhat like this:





I have an unpopulated blank PCB board and the following components:

All necessary transformers, all high quality R-type
The necessary PCM1704, DF1704, and CS8414 chips (very expensive!)
Regulator chips and heatsinks for regulators (hard to find)
All other semiconductors (excluding diodes and rectifiers)

I will provide a detailed schematic along with the kit. All the required parts are very clearly labeled on the board, so collecting parts and assembling the kit should be a breeze. The main DAC chips are all in SOP/SSOP format so you'll need to get converters for these chips.
